Take your first breath underwater just minutes from Waikiki with a beginner-friendly beach dive at Magic Island in Ala Moana Beach Park. No certification or previous scuba experience is required, making this a comfortable way to discover what diving feels like without committing to a boat trip.
Every tour begins with a safety briefing and hands-on equipment practice in shallow water. Once you feel comfortable, your instructor will guide the group into the ocean by beach entry and stay with you throughout the experience. All diving equipment is included, and guests who prefer not to scuba may snorkel instead.
Children may participate even if a parent does not plan to dive. The parent must be present at check-in to sign the waiver forms and remain close by for the tour duration.

Restrictions
Minimum age is 10 years old.
All participants under the age of 18 must have a parent or guardian there to sign a waiver form.
All participants should be in good physical health and be comfortable in the water.
No starting a dive within 8 hours of diving and no flying after 8 hours of ending a dive.
A medical questionnaire will be filled out at check-in. Below is a list of the questions. Any yes would require a doctor's note clearing the guest to participate.
Do you currently have an ear infection?
Do you have a history of ear disease, hearing loss, or problems with balance?
Do you have a history of ear or sinus surgery?
Are you currently suffering from a cold, congestion, sinusitis or bronchitis?
Do you have a history of respiratory problems, severe attacks of hayfever or allergies, or lung disease?
Have you had a collapsed lung (pneumothorax) or history of chest surger?
Do you have active asthma or history of emphysema or tuberculosis?
Are you currently taking medication that carries a warning about any impairments of your physical or mental abilities?
Do you have behavioral health, mental or psychological problems or a nervous system disorder?
Are you or could you be pregnant?
Do you have a history of colostomy?
Do you have a history of heart disease or heart attack, heart surgery or blood vessel surgery?
Do you have a history of high blood pressure, angina, or take medication to control blood pressure?
Are you over 45 and have a family history of heart attack or stroke?
Do you have a history of bleeding or other blood disorders?
Do you have a history of diabetes?
Do you have a history of seizures, blackouts or fainting, convulsions or epilepsy or take medications to prevent them?
Do you have a history of back, arm, or leg problems following an injury, fracture, or surgery?
Do you have a history of fear of closed or open spaces or panic attacks (claustrophobia or agoraphobia)?
